Guangzhou (China) — More than half a million people have signed an online petition calling for the closure of a theme park in the Chinese city of Guangzhou, where a polar bear is on show. The Arctic animal, who goes by the name of Pizza, is the main attraction for people visiting the Grandview shopping centre. But animal-rights groups say conditions in the theme park are incredibly poor and have called for the polar bear to be moved.
“This obviously affects him psychologically and behaviourally, which then affects his level of happiness,” Karina O’Carroll, of Animals Asia, said.
The manager of the theme park has dismissed allegations that the polar bear was being mistreated, and accused the animal-rights groups as also the international media of conducting a witch-hunt against him and his colleagues.
Nevertheless, many of the spectators are also expressing their concern for the bear. “This place is very small,” one woman said. “The bear is playing by himself. He’s lonely, and he needs interactions.” — Al Jazeera
